Output 65fa05d6a2f0be42fd3ee5025ef577e3fbfa69303dfe16c9f39a02405ade2a00:115

value
1580942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fef7947eb65344dd63876db98c484276e715c5c0 OP_EQUAL
address
3QwA9S3v25muhmfaBrAbrVjerGgPR86Xtm
transaction
65fa05d6a2f0be42fd3ee5025ef577e3fbfa69303dfe16c9f39a02405ade2a00
spent
true